Jeremiah Smith’s commitment to Ohio State football marks a significant moment in college football, not just for the Buckeyes but for the broader landscape of recruitment and player development. A highly coveted 5-star wide receiver from Chaminade-Madonna Prep in Florida, Smith’s decision to choose Ohio State over several top-tier programs is a statement of both personal ambition and the growing power of the Buckeye football program. His commitment has significant implications for Ohio State’s future success and the ongoing evolution of college football recruiting.
Smith is widely regarded as one of the top high school football prospects in the country, with an exceptional skill set that combines speed, size, and hands that can catch almost anything thrown his way. At 6-foot-3 and 195 pounds, he has the physical tools to dominate at the college level, making him a prime target for several of the nation’s most prestigious football programs. One of the primary reasons why Smith’s decision to commit to Ohio State is so important is the way it reinforces the program’s reputation as a wide receiver factory. Ohio State has long been recognized for producing top-tier wide receivers, and in recent years, the school has seen players like Marvin Harrison Jr., Garrett Wilson, and Chris Olave become high NFL Draft picks. Smith’s commitment adds to this legacy and positions Ohio State to continue churning out some of the best wideouts in college football. With quarterbacks like Kyle McCord (and future recruits like Lincoln Kienholz) in the fold, the synergy between elite pass-catchers and signal-callers promises to keep Ohio State near the top of the national rankings.
